When invoking the audit broadcast command, provide a few environment
variables so that people can customize the format of the message if they
want.
We currently provide `MRSK_PERFORMER`, `MRSK_ROLE`, `MRSK_DESTINATION` and
`MRSK_EVENT`.
Also adds the destination to the default message, which we continue to
send as the first argument as before.
If we get an error we'll only hold the deploy lock if it occurs while
trying to switch the running containers.
We'll also move tagging the latest image from when the image is pulled
to just before the container switch. This ensures that earlier errors
don't leave the hosts with an updated latest tag while still running the
older version.

Accounts for the 2.9.10 security release and allows testing Traefik 3 betas.
* Use `image` to configure a specific Traefik Docker image.
* Default to `traefik:v2.9` to track future 2.9.x minor releases rather
than tightly pinning to `v2.9.9`.
* Support images from the configured registry.
References #165

Allow the hosts for accessories to be specified by host or role, or on
all app hosts by setting `daemon: true`.
```
# Single host
mysql:
host: 1.1.1.1
# Multiple hosts
redis:
hosts:
- 1.1.1.1
- 1.1.1.2
# By role
monitoring:
roles:
- web
- jobs
```
When deploying check if there is already a container with the existing
name. If there is rename it to "<version>_<random_hex_string>" to remove
the name clash with the new container we want to boot.
We can then do the normal zero downtime run/wait/stop.
While implementing this I discovered the --filter name=foo does a
substring match for foo, so I've updated those filters to do an exact
match instead.
